Snap (NYSE:SNAP – Get Rating) had its price target cut by JMP Securities from $65.00 to $50.00 in a report released on Friday, Benzinga reports. They currently have a market outperform rating on the stock.
Several other equities analysts have also weighed in on the stock. Cowen lowered shares of Snap from an outperform rating to a market perform rating and dropped their price objective for the company from $75.00 to $45.00 in a report on Thursday, January 13th. Morgan Stanley cut their price target on Snap from $60.00 to $59.00 and set an overweight rating on the stock in a report on Tuesday, March 29th. Deutsche Bank Aktiengesellschaft assumed coverage on Snap in a research note on Friday, March 11th. They issued a buy rating and a $45.00 price objective for the company. Royal Bank of Canada lowered Snap from an outperform rating to a sector perform rating and lowered their target price for the stock from $54.00 to $40.00 in a research report on Friday, February 4th. Finally, Atlantic Securities reduced their price target on shares of Snap from $85.00 to $70.00 and set an overweight rating for the company in a research report on Friday, February 4th. One equities research anal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, seven have issued a hold rating and twenty-four have assigned a buy rating to the company’s stock. Based on data from MarketBeat, the company currently has an average rating of Buy and an average price target of $54.26.
Shares of SNAP stock opened at $29.42 on Friday. Snap has a fifty-two week low of $24.32 and a fifty-two week high of $83.34.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.59, a quick ratio of 5.70 and a current ratio of 5.70. The stock has a 50 day simple moving average of $35.42 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$44.63. The company has a market cap of $47.79 billion, a P/E ratio of -89.15 and a beta of 1.09.
In other Snap news, CAO Rebecca Morrow sold 8,405 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Monday, April 18th. The shares were sold at an average price of $32.25, for a total transaction of $271,061.25.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ief accounting officer now owns 229,383 shares in the company, valued at $7,397,601.75.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through the SEC website. Also, CFO Derek Andersen sold 8,185 shares of Snap st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, February 15th. The stock was sold at an average price of $40.28, for a total transaction of $329,691.80.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. Over the last three months, insiders have sold 1,243,234 shares of company stock valued at $47,018,853.

Snap Company Profile (Get Rating)
Snap Inc operates as a camera company in North America, Europe, and internationally. The company offers Snapchat, a camera application with various functionalities, such as Camera, Communication, Snap Map, Stories, and Spotlight that enable people to communicate visually through short videos and images.
